La Nación
When we talk about Argentina's top newspapers, La Nación is almost always at the top of the list. Founded in 1870 by Bartolomé Mitre, who was also a former president of Argentina, La Nación has a long and prestigious history. Its headquarters are in Buenos Aires, and it's known for its comprehensive coverage and in-depth analysis. La Nación isn’t just about reporting news; it's about providing context and understanding, making it a favorite among intellectuals, academics, and anyone who appreciates a well-researched article. The newspaper has a broad reach, both in print and online, and is considered one of the most influential newspapers in the country.

Buenos Aires Herald
Now, for those of you who prefer to read your news in English, the Buenos Aires Herald is your go-to newspaper. Founded in 1876, the Buenos Aires Herald is Argentina's oldest English-language newspaper. It originally served the British community in Argentina, but it has since evolved to become a valuable source of information for expats, tourists, and anyone who wants to stay informed about Argentina from an international perspective.
The Buenos Aires Herald covers a wide range of topics, including national and international news, politics, business, culture, and sports. It’s particularly known for its coverage of Argentine politics and economics, providing insights that you won't find in other English-language publications. The newspaper also has a strong online presence, with a website that offers a mix of news articles, opinion pieces, and multimedia content. The Buenos Aires Herald's website is a valuable resource for anyone who wants to stay informed about Argentina in English.
The Buenos Aires Herald's editorial stance is generally considered to be center-left, and it often provides a platform for progressive voices. However, it also publishes a wide range of opinions and perspectives, making it a valuable source of information for anyone who wants to understand the complexities of Argentine society. The newspaper has a long and proud history of defending freedom of the press and human rights in Argentina. During the country's military dictatorship in the 1970s and 1980s, the Buenos Aires Herald was one of the few newspapers that dared to report on the atrocities committed by the regime. Its courageous reporting helped to bring international attention to the human rights situation in Argentina and played a role in the restoration of democracy.
Ámbito Financiero
If you're interested in business and finance, Ámbito Financiero is the newspaper you need to be reading. Founded in 1976, Ámbito Financiero specializes in economic and financial news. It provides in-depth coverage of the Argentine economy, the stock market, and the business world. If you're an investor, entrepreneur, or business professional, Ámbito Financiero will keep you informed about the latest trends and developments in the Argentine economy.
Ámbito Financiero covers a wide range of topics, including macroeconomics, microeconomics, financial markets, and corporate news.
